Monument record MDO2330 - Lime kiln at Common Lane, Ryme Intrinseca

Please read our .

Summary

A limekiln shown on the 1:25 inch scale Ordnance Survey map surveyed in 1886. on which it is described as 'Limekiln'. A site visit by Peter Stanier in 1992-3 found no trace of the structure.
